A left B : 包含A所有記錄
A = B : AB相交的記錄
A = B : AB相交的記錄
解决方案 »
- 我遇到了这样的情况,没有想出来应该如何写view语句?
- 超难 SQL 语句问题(请邹建帮帮忙)不好意思,分不多了!
- SQL中,同一题目使用“联接”与“子查询”哪一种效率高呢?
- 如何在osql命令行中直接执行.sql脚本文件?
- 存储过程的问题,请教大虾1
- 如何在存储过程中引入单引号
- 建视图的简单问题
- 求一结果集,急,小弟愚笨请各位大大帮忙,在线等!
- 调试自己编写的存储过程时,您是怎么跟踪的程序运行情况的?
- 请教MSSQL里边怎样能把批量的结果写入到同一个单元格里边?
- 求教大家:我想取出每个分类最新的一条记录,然后联合,但是union中的order by 无法使用?如何解决?谢谢!!!
- 关于isnull函数在存储过程中的使用问题
在早期的 Microsoft® SQL Server™ 2000 版本中,使用 *= 和 =* 在 WHERE 子句中指定左、右外部联接条件。有时,该语法会导致有多种解释的不明确查询。FROM 子句中指定遵从 SQL-92 的外部联接,不会导致上述不确定性。因为 SQL-92 语法更为精确,所以,本版中未包括有关在 WHERE 子句中使用旧的 Transact-SQL 外部联接语法的详细信息。以后的 SQL Server 版本可能不再支持该语法。任何使用 Transact-SQL 外部联接的语句都应改为使用 SQL-92 语法。SQL-92 标准支持 FROM 或 WHERE 子句中的内部联接规范。WHERE 子句中指定的内部联接不会出现与 Transact-SQL 外部联接语法相同的不确定性问题。
在早期的 Microsoft® SQL Server™ 2000 版本中,使用 *= 和 =* 在 WHERE 子句中指定左、右外部联接条件。有时,该语法会导致有多种解释的不明确查询。FROM 子句中指定遵从 SQL-92 的外部联接,不会导致上述不确定性。因为 SQL-92 语法更为精确,所以,本版中未包括有关在 WHERE 子句中使用旧的 Transact-SQL 外部联接语法的详细信息。以后的 SQL Server 版本可能不再支持该语法。任何使用 Transact-SQL 外部联接的语句都应改为使用 SQL-92 语法。SQL-92 标准支持 FROM 或 WHERE 子句中的内部联接规范。WHERE 子句中指定的内部联接不会出现与 Transact-SQL 外部联接语法相同的不确定性问题。LEFT JOIN 或 LEFT OUTER JOIN。
左向外联接的结果集包括 LEFT OUTER 子句中指定的左表的所有行,而不仅仅是联接列所匹配的行。如果左表的某行在右表中没有匹配行,则在相关联的结果集行中右表的所有选择列表列均为空值。这种解释在sql帮助中能找的!要学会怎么用帮助啊!